Recently, the rise in popularity of home daycare facilities has been on the rise. With additional plus moms and dads pursuing versatile and affordable childcare options, home daycare providers have grown to be a favorite option for many families. But as with every style of childcare arrangement, you can find both benefits and drawbacks to take into account in terms of house daycare.

One of many advantages of home Daycare Near Me could be the personalized care and attention that kids receive. Unlike bigger daycare facilities, home daycare providers typically have smaller sets of kiddies to look after, allowing them to provide each kid more personalized interest. This is particularly beneficial for children just who may require extra help or have special requirements. Also, house daycare providers often have more mobility inside their schedules, allowing them to accommodate the requirements of working moms and dads and also require non-traditional work hours.

Another advantage of residence daycare is the home-like environment that young ones can experience. In a home daycare setting, children can play and learn in an appropriate and familiar environment, which can help them feel better and relaxed. This could be especially good for youngsters which may have a problem with separation anxiety whenever being left in a larger, much more institutionalized daycare setting.

Residence daycare providers also often have even more flexibility with regards to curriculum and activities. In a home daycare environment, providers have the freedom to tailor their particular programs toward certain needs and passions associated with young ones inside their treatment. This will provide for even more creative and individualized understanding experiences, and this can be beneficial for kiddies of all many years.

Despite these benefits, there are some downsides to think about in terms of residence daycare. One of the most significant issues that moms and dads may have could be the decreased oversight and legislation in residence daycare services. Unlike larger daycare facilities, which are often at the mercy of strict licensing demands and laws, house daycare providers is almost certainly not held towards exact same standards. This may boost issues in regards to the quality and protection of care that young ones obtain in these options.

Another possible disadvantage of house daycare could be the restricted socialization opportunities that children could have. In a property daycare environment, children are generally just reaching a small band of colleagues, that may maybe not give them exactly the same level of socialization and exposure to diverse experiences that they would obtain in a more substantial daycare center. This is often an issue for parents which price socialization and peer interaction as crucial the different parts of the youngster's development.

Also, home daycare providers may face challenges about managing their particular caregiving duties due to their individual life. Numerous residence daycare providers are self-employed and can even struggle to get a hold of a work-life stability, particularly if they are looking after kiddies in their own personal domiciles. This may induce burnout and anxiety, which can in the end affect the standard of treatment that kiddies receive.

In general, house daycare could be a fantastic choice for people to locate versatile and personalized childcare options. But is very important for parents to carefully consider the positives and negatives of home daycare before deciding. By evaluating the professionals and cons of home daycare and performing thorough study on possible providers, moms and dads can make sure that they truly are determing the best childcare option for their children.

Finally, house daycare are a valuable and enriching knowledge for children, offering all of them with tailored attention, a home-like environment, and flexible programming. But moms and dads should become aware of the possibility disadvantages, like restricted oversight and socialization possibilities, and take steps to ensure these are generally picking a professional and top-notch house daycare provider.
